Struct ProllyTransaction 

Source
pub struct ProllyTransaction<'a, S>{ /* private fields */ }
Expand description

A strict optimistic transaction over a Prolly manager.

Implementations§

Source§

impl<'a, S> ProllyTransaction<'a, S>

Source

pub fn create(&self) -> Tree

Create an empty tree using the base manager’s config.

Source

pub fn get(&self, tree: &Tree, key: &[u8]) -> Result<Option<Vec<u8>>, Error>

Get a value from a tree, including nodes staged in this transaction.

Source

pub fn put( &self, tree: &Tree, key: Vec<u8>, value: Vec<u8>, ) -> Result<Tree, Error>

Insert or update a key/value pair, staging rewritten nodes.

Source

pub fn delete(&self, tree: &Tree, key: &[u8]) -> Result<Tree, Error>

Delete a key, staging rewritten nodes.

Source

pub fn batch( &self, tree: &Tree, mutations: Vec<Mutation>, ) -> Result<Tree, Error>

Apply a batch of logical map mutations inside the transaction.

Source

pub fn load_named_root(&self, name: &[u8]) -> Result<Option<Tree>, Error>

Load a named root and add it to the transaction read set.

Source

pub fn publish_named_root(&self, name: &[u8], tree: &Tree) -> Result<(), Error>

Stage an unconditional named-root publish.

Source

pub fn delete_named_root(&self, name: &[u8]) -> Result<(), Error>

Stage an unconditional named-root delete.

Source

pub fn compare_and_swap_named_root( &self, name: &[u8], expected: Option<&Tree>, new: Option<&Tree>, ) -> Result<NamedRootUpdate, Error>

Stage a named-root CAS update.

Source

pub fn rollback(self)

Discard all staged writes. Dropping an uncommitted transaction has the same effect; this method is useful when callers want to be explicit.

Source

pub fn commit(self) -> Result<TransactionUpdate, Error>

Commit staged node and named-root writes atomically.
